The President of the United States of America takes pride in presenting the Silver Star (Posthumously) to First Lieutenant Thomas A. C. Crimmins (MCSN: 0-30953), United States Marine Corps Reserve, for conspicuous gallantry and intrepidity as a member of a Forward Observation Team, attached to Battery B, First Battalion, Fifteenth Marines, SIXTH Marine Division in action against enemy Japanese forces during the drive on Naha, Okinawa Shima, Ryukyu Islands on 9 May 1945. Remaining in an exposed position on a hill under heavy Japanese mortar, machine gun and small arms fire, First Lieutenant Crimmins accurately adjusted artillery fire on hostile mortars that had trapped the Marine infantry battalion with which he was serving. Mortally wounded by enemy Rifle fire, First Lieutenant Crimmins, by his heroic devotion to duty and cool courage in the face of grave danger had sided in silencing enemy fire and, upheld the highest traditions of the United States Naval Service. He gallantly gave his life for his country.
